  2. Mandolin Mondays w/ Special Guest Reed Stutz

    This week on Mandolin Mondays we've got the great Reed Stutz with us to play the "Laurel Mountain Breakdown" on his 1927 Gibson F5.



    Reed Stutz is a Durham, North Carolina based mandolin player, singer, and multi-instrumentalist. He plays in a trio with Alice Gerrard & Tatiana Hargreaves, among other groups, and his playing and singing can be heard all over Bella White’s album “Just Like Leaving” on Rounder Records. ...
  3. Mandolin Mondays #284 w/ Special Guest Joon Laukamp

    This week on Mandolin Mondays, Joon Laukamp from Cologne, Germany joins us for a relatable original composition called "Help Me, I'm Trapped in a Zoom Meeting" played on his Gibson F9 mandolin.

  4. Mandolin Mondays #280 w/ Special Guest C.E. Jones

    This week on Mandolin Mondays, classical mandolinist and composer C.E. Jones joins us for a beautiful performance of the "Allemande" from Cello Suite No. 1 by J.S. Bach played on this Gibson F9.

  6. Mandolin Mondays #214 w/ Special Guest Daniel Patrick

    Mandolins and Beer podcast host Daniel Patrick brings an original cross-tuned composition to Mandolin Mondays with his trusty Gibson F5G axe in tow.

  7. Mandolin Mondays #171 w/ Special Guest David Harvey

    This week on Mandolin Mondays Gibson master luthier David Harvey brings us an original cross-tuned piece performed on this incredible Gibson Hall Of Fame Mon F-5 prototype he helped to pioneer.
